/********************Item Detail ******************/



table.catalogDetail
{
	width: 95%;
}

table.place_order
{
	width: 80%;
}

td.catalogDetail_note
{
	height: 300px;
}

td.place_order_detail
{
	height: 600;
}

td.catalogDetail_button
{
	width: 150px;
}

td.bottom_html {width: 70%; /* height: 1500px;*/}

td.catalogDetail_CItemNum
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 600}

td.catalogDetail_ItemNum
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 600; width: 70% }

td.catalogDetail_CRefItemNum
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 600}

td.catalogDetail_RefItemNum
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 600; width: 70% }


td.catalogDetail_CCustomerItemNum
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}

td.catalogDetail_CustomerItemNum
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}


td.catalogDetail
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400
}

td.catalogDetail_Caption
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400
}

/**
td.item_info
{
 background-color: #F7F5EF;
 border-top: #999999 1px solid;
 border-left: #999999 1px solid;
 border-bottom: #999999 1px solid;
 border-right: #999999 1px solid;
 padding-bottom: 10px;
 padding-left: 5 px;
 padding-right: 5 px;
 width: 100% 
}
**/
.catalogNote_Detail
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	font-style: italic;
	vertical-align: top;
}

.catalogNote_Caption
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 600;
	vertical-align: top;
	
}

.catalogAdditional_Detail
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	font-style: italic;
	vertical-align: top;
}

.catalogAdditional_Caption
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 600;
	vertical-align: top;
}


/********************Price Break ******************/
td.priceBreak_Heading
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400
}

td.priceBreak_Caption
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
}

.priceBreak_Caption
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
}

td.priceBreak_Detail
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
}

.priceBreak_Detail
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	vertical-align: middle;
}

td.catalogHeading a
{
	font-family: Verdana;
	font-size: 12px;
	color: #007EA1;
	font-weight: 700
}

td.catalogHeading 
{
	font-family: Verdana;
	font-size: 12px;
	color: #007EA1;
	font-weight: 700
}


td.catalogHeading0 
{
	font-family: Verdana;
	font-size: 12px;
	color: #007EA1;
	font-weight: 700
}

td.catalogHeading1 
{
	font-family: Verdana;
	font-size: 12px;
	color: #007EA1;
	font-weight: 700
}

td.catalogHeading2 
{
	font-family: Verdana;
	font-size: 14px;
	color: #007EA1;
	font-weight: 700
}


/********************Related Items*****************************/



td.related_caption 
{
	font-family: Verdana;
	font-size: 10px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
}

.related_caption 
{
	font-family: Verdana;
	font-size: 10px;
	color: #cccccc;
	font-weight: 400;
	vertical-align: top;
}

td.related_value_item 
{
	font-family: Verdana;
	font-size: 10px;
	color: #0617F9;
	font-weight: 500;
	vertical-align: top;
	text-decoration: underline;
}

td.related_value_price 
{
	font-family: Verdana;
	font-size: 10px;
	color: #FB2D04;
	font-weight: 500;
	vertical-align: top;
}

td.related_value 
{
	font-family: Verdana;
	font-size: 10px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
}

table.related_table1
{
    WIDTH: 200px;    
    padding: 0px 0px 0px 0px;
}



table.related_table2
{
	width: 200px;
	
}

td.related_table2_heading 
{
	font-family: Verdana;
	font-size: 11px;
	color: #000000;
	font-weight: 400;
	vertical-align: top;
	background: #C8C7C7;
	padding-bottom: 2px;
}

td.related_type 
{
	font-family: Verdana;
	font-size: 11px;
	color: #9D9B9B;
	font-weight: 600;
	vertical-align: top;
	text-align: left;
	padding-bottom: 2px;
}

table.related_table3
{
	padding: 0px;	
}

img.small_th
{
	/***** width: 40px; height: 40px;*****/
}

td.color1
{
	background-color: #ffffff;
	
}

td.color2
{
	background-color: #f2f2f2;
	
}

td.optDesc_Level0_Caption { font-family: Verdana; font-size:2px; font-weight:400; color: #F7F5EF;}
td.optDesc_Level0 { font-family: Verdana; font-size:2px; font-weight:normal; color: #F7F5EF;}

.promoEnd {font-size: 11px; height: 11px; font-weight:lighter; color: #999999;}


.oclass1 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}
.oclass2 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}
.oclass3 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}
.oclass4 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}
.oclass5 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}
.oclass6 {font-family: Helvetica; font-size: 13px; color: #391E13; font-weight: 400; width:80;}

.catalogDetail_include {font-family: Helvetica; font-size: 11px; color: #000000; font-weight: 400; }
img.img_option
{ vertical-align: middle;}

body
{	background-color: #ffffff;}


/** Customer Item **/
td.catalogDetail_CCustomerItemNum
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}

td.catalogDetail_CustomerItemNum
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emDesc
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emDesc
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emShortName
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emShortName
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emGeneric
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emGeneric
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emText1
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emText1
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emText2
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emText2
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emText3
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emText3
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emText4
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emText4
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

td.catalogDetail_CCustomerItemText5
{font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400}
td.catalogDetail_CustomerItemText5
{ font-family: Verdana; font-size: 11px; color: #000000; font-weight: 400; width: 70% }

/** Customer Item **/

/********* Configurator **************/

.config_opt_LinerName {font-family: Verdana; font-size: 0px; color: #ffffff;}
.config_opt_value_LinerName {font-family: Verdana; font-size: 0px; color: #ffffff;}

.config_opt_ShoeSize {font-family: Verdana; font-size: 0px; color: #ffffff;}
.config_opt_value_ShoeSize {font-family: Verdana; font-size: 0px; color: #ffffff;}

/********* Configurator ****************/
